The PHENIX experiment at RHIC has measured the centrality dependence of the direct photon yield from Au+Au collisions at $\sqrt{s_{NN}}$ = 200 GeV down to $p_T$ = 0.4 GeV/$c$. Photons are detected via photon conversions to $e^+e^−$ pairs and an improved technique is applied that minimizes the systematic uncertainties that usually limit direct photon measurements, in particular at low $p_T$. We find an excess of direct photons above the $N_{coll}$-scaled yield measured in $p$+$p$ collisions. This excess yield is well described by an exponential distribution with an inverse slope of about 240 MeV/$c$ in the $p_T$ range from 0.6 - 2.0 GeV/$c$. While the shape of the $p_T$ distribution is independent of centrality within the experimental uncertainties, the yield increases rapidly with increasing centrality, scaling approximately with $N_{part}^{\alpha}$, where $\alpha$ = 1.38 $\pm$ 0.03(stat) $\pm$ 0.07(syst).

Integrated thermal photon yields as a function of $N_{part}$ for different lower $p_T$ integration limits.
